Tomas Blomquist is a Professor in Business Administration at Umeå University, specializing in the fields of innovation, digitalization, Internet of Things (IoT), business models, entrepreneurship, project management, and career development. He has a distinguished record as an educator, recognized as a distinguished university teacher at Umeå University. Blomquist’s research focuses on bridging theoretical concepts with practical applications within the evolving business landscape, particularly at the intersection of technology and management. His work frequently examines how digital advancements are transforming business practices. He has published numerous articles in prestigious journals, contributing to knowledge in project management and human resource management, among others. In addition, he leads research groups focusing on entrepreneurial ecosystems and new venture creation, with various projects aimed at enhancing innovation in business contexts. Blomquist has received accolades for his teaching, including the Umeå University Pedagogical Prize in 2007 and recognition as a distinguished teacher in 2022.
